## Formula sandbox tuning

User-supplied formulas in Gridmoor execute inside a restricted interpreter with hard ceilings on time, memory, and call depth. Reviewers should confirm any change to these ceilings is justified in the PR description, since raising them widens the abuse surface. Defaults were chosen from production traces. The current limits are as follows.

limits module of tafog-fawip:
WEIGHTS = {
    "julix": 57,
    "lamys": 992,
    "kasvan": 209,
    "quenok": 750,
    "alddor": 259,
    "oliath": 1009,
    "wenix": 815,
}

Subject: Quickstore 4.2 — bloom filter now fronts the KV layer

Plugin authors: starting with this release, Quickstore places a bloom filter ahead of the key-value store. Negative lookups return faster; false positives fall through safely. No API changes are required on your side. Verify your plugin against the staging build referenced below.

session token of fahif-tadup = htk3_9c7

The cut-over finished last night. The events table is now partitioned by month; legacy rows were backfilled into twelve historical partitions and verified by row counts. Old table is renamed, read-only, and scheduled for drop in thirty days. Access paths are unchanged — the partitioned parent uses the same grants, and no new roles were created. Retention jobs now detach partitions rather than deleting rows. For your review, the partition manager runs with the following configuration.

service settings:
PRAIX_LOG_LEVEL=error
PRAIX_METRICS_HOST=metrics.praix.qorvelcorp.corp
PRAIX_POOL_SIZE=16

**Ticket TZ-EXPORT: Vault locked during report fix**

For the weekly sync: the Lanternfield report exporter renders timestamps in account-local timezones now, not UTC. The fix is merged but the config vault holding the timezone override map locked itself after failed rotations. To reopen the vault and verify the mapping, use the recovery passphrase given below.

unlock words, kawig-bawef: belax-sorir-druax-ulaiel-wenael-belael